In today's episode I sat down with Whitney Otto who is a seasoned executive coach and facilitator who has worked with groups and individuals for more than twenty years. Whitney is also an author, podcast host, mom of two kids, and a former US world rowing champion.In this conversation, we discuss all things body image including:
- How negative body image often stems from past experiences, unmet needs, and societal conditioning.
- How athletes (and anyone with a body) can prepare for bad body image moments and turn those into opportunities for mental toughness.
- The societal pressures and how injuries also play a role in competitive environments and shape body image issues for women.
- Practical strategies that not only female athletes but anyone who has a body can adopt to build a collaborative and empowering relationship with their bodies.
